Target
Unethical methods

I was checking out in a Target store and the clerk asked if I would like a Target special customer card. She said I would get 5% discount off my purchases. I told her I didn't want a credit card, and she said it was a discount card, and she could take my info. quickly and get me checked out. I thought this was like my Kroger grocery card that gives me a discount on certain purchases. After she entered my purchases, she ran my debit card, so I assumed my purchases were on my debit card. Next month I got a bill for the purchases, checked my bank and nothing was paid out of that account. However, the purchases had to be paid in full within 30 days or I would be hit with a 29.96% interest. I called the company and told them to cancel the card; then I was 2 days late on one payment and got hit with their interest and a $25 charge. I will never again go into a Target store. BTW: I was told by a former employee that they are encouraged to "hook" customers into the credit cards. I can pay my off; what about poor people who never get out from under that debt.
